### Audit Item 22 — Digest Scheduling

Verify the Mailloom batch digest scheduler: cron expressions stored per tenant, validated on write; no overlapping runs (check the lock table); timezone handling uses tenant-local midnight, not server time; retries capped at three with exponential backoff; dead-letter digests surfaced in the ops dashboard. Confirm the quiet-hours override cannot be bypassed via the admin API. Record evidence links in the audit log. Escalations for failed findings go to the designated owner.

named custodian: Brivan Eliath Quenox Frador

Key ceremony checklist — item 7 of 12 (Bramblewick loyalty-points ledger). Quick heads-up for the new contractor: this step is the fun one. Once the quorum holders have tapped in, you initialize the signing key that notarizes daily point balances on the Lanternfield ledger. Double-check the ceremony laptop is offline, the witness has signed the log sheet, and the tamper bag is sealed. When the console prompts for unlock, enter the recovery passphrase shown below.

vault phrase of tawip-faweg = fraok-holdor-zorwyn-belox-ulador-aldix-quenael-lamox-juleth-lamion

Action item from the Tinderbox Giving receipt-mailer incident: the retry storm happened because we retried bounced sends as aggressively as transient SMTP hiccups, which hammered the relay and got us rate-limited for six hours. Fix is to split the backoff schedules and cap the batch fan-out. I've already sanity-checked these numbers against last quarter's send volumes, so please just eyeball the logic, not the math. New constants below.

tuning constants:
RATE_LIMITS = {
    "ralwyn": 5,
    "zorael": 2,
}

A quick note on the Larkmill broker upgrade: the new version changes default prefetch behavior, so plugins that assumed unlimited prefetch will see throughput dips. We're pinning explicit values rather than trusting upstream defaults, and plugins should read these at connect time instead of hardcoding. The pinned values are as follows:

limits module of tafof-kagef:
RATE_LIMITS = {
    "zorix": 10,
    "ralath": 1,
    "quenwyn": 2,
    "holael": 10,
}